Angelina Jolie’s ex opens up: ‘I never felt good enough for her’

Billy Bob Thornton says he always felt 'uncomfortable' around the rich and famous

They were famous for wearing a vial of each other’s blood round their necks – and boasting to reporters about having sex in limos before red carpet appearances.

But now Angelina Jolie’s ex Billy Bob Thornton has revealed he never felt good enough for the actress during their tumultuous relationship.

In a revealing interview with GQ, Billy Bob said the pair had massively different interests during their marriage – which made him feel inadequate.

The actress was always going off to meet with “U.N. people or the president or adoptions agencies” while Billy Bob just wanted to stay home and watch baseball, the magazine reported.

“I never felt good enough for her…and I’m real uncomfortable around rich and important people,” he said.

But the Bad Santa 2 star said he didn’t really want to change his ways – or learn how to “act fancy”.

“I like how I am,” he added.

The 61-year-old married Angelina in 2000 – years before she met Brad Pitt on the set of Mr and Mrs Smith in 2004.

Despite divorcing in 2003, just three months after Angelina adopted first child Maddox, the pair are still friends and they talk every few months.

And Billy Bob revealed he STILL has two tattoos of Angelina’s name on his body.

One is on his leg while the other on his arm with an angel covering it.

“See, it’s just resting there …You can still see the name,” he added.

Billy Bob is now married to his sixth wife Connie Angland and the couple have a 12-year-old daughter Bella. Angelina meanwhile is currently divorcing Brad Pitt, after splitting with him amid claims of child abuse.
